COMMENTS SOUGHT ON PROPOSED GAS PIPELINE EXPANSION PROJECT

The Federal Energy Regulatory Commission is seeking comments on revisions to the proposed Ridgeline Expansion Project natural gas pipeline.

This current comment period, which is open through February 26, 2024, is in response to changes East Tennessee Natural Gas proposed along the final part of the project, mostly in Morgan and Roane counties.

The purpose of this proposed project is to provide natural gas to serve one of the power generation options that TVA is currently considering to replace the Kingston Fossil Plant. Replacing coal-fired generation at the Kingston Fossil Plant with natural gas would provide Tennesseans with a lower-carbon, cleaner-burning energy source as we transition toward the future.

The proposed scope includes the installation of approximately 117 miles of 30-inch pipeline looping, an approximately 8-mile 24-inch lateral, and one electric-powered compressor station.

The majority of the route for the proposed pipeline would be located within the existing system’s right-of-way where possible to minimize impacts to landowners and the environment.

Pending a positive final investment decision and the approval and receipt of all necessary permits, construction would begin in 2025 with a target in-service date of fall 2026.
